Robert Prigg

ROBERT PRIGG: LL.B (Hons) Partner Solicitor

Robert Prigg is a specialist in family law, dealing with all aspects of family breakdown.

He gained a 2:1 Honours degree in Law from the University of Central England and passed all heads of the Law Society Finals at the College of Law, York. He trained with Parry Carver and following qualification became a Partner in 1995.

Robert is a Member of Resolution (formerly the Solicitors Family Law Association); he is an accredited specialist in family law as an approved member of the Law Society's Advanced Family Law Panel; he is a solicitor member of the Solicitors Disciplinary Tribunal and also sits as a Deputy District Judge.

Robert also works as a Consultant for the Peer Review Team of the Legal Services Commission assessing and auditing the quality of other firms.

In addition to family law Robert also practices in Civil Litigation, Employment Law and Wills and Probate. This enables him to offer a holistic service to all of his family clients who may, as a consequence of the breakdown of the relationship, have ancillary issues that also need resolving.

Robert is able to offer a comprehensive service to clients from his offices at Wellington.

Sam Hoyle

SAMANTHA HOYLE: BA (Hons) Partner Solicitor

Samantha joined Parry Carver as a Trainee Solicitor in April 2001 having read Law and German at the University of Wolverhampton attaining a 2:1 degree with honours and thereafter a Post Graduate Diploma in Legal Practice.

From the outset Samantha has demonstrated a keen interest and strong commitment to the area of Family Law.

Since her qualification as a Solicitor in October 2002 she has continued to work alongside Mr Robert Prigg, the Head of the Family Department, in developing an ever expanding team of experienced staff, with whom client's may discuss the very often traumatic circumstances of their relationship breakdown and whom they may reliably entrust the resolution of their personal affairs.

Since becoming a Partner in October 2006 Samantha has continued to specialise in all areas of family law, namely the separation and/or divorce of married couples, disputes arising between cohabiting parties; the dissolution of civil partnerships and all aspects of private law proceedings in respect of issues and arrangements relating to children.
